About Janwillem Kocks

Janwillem Kocks is a scholar working on Issues, ethics and legal aspects,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Physiology, having authored 16 papers that have together received 130 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(11 papers), Asthma and respiratory diseases (7 papers) and Respiratory and Cough-Related Research (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Issues, ethics and legal aspects (6 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(104 citations) and Physiology (80 citations). Janwillem Kocks has collaborated with scholars based in Netherlands, Singapore and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Esther Metting, Thys van der Molen, Job F. M. van Boven, Robbert Sanderman, Maarten J. Postma, Miguel Román-Rodríguez, Rudi Peché, R.A. Riemersma, Jane Scullion and Margriet Piersma‐Wichers. Their work appears in journals such as European Respiratory Journal, BMJ Open and Clinical & Experimental Allergy.
